
Make a natural look Christmas tree with wood pieces and jute fabric. Decorate with ribbons and pearl embellishments.

Materials
- Gathered Small Drift Wood Pieces
- Knorr Prandell Polystyrene Cone 1pc – 20cm
- Knorr Prandell 100cm (39″) wide Jute Hessian Fabric – 1m Natural
- Tsukineko StazOn Pigment Ink Pad – Chocolate Brown
- Buddly Crafts Woven Gingham Ribbon 3m – 9mm Red A03
- Buddly Crafts 15mm Flatback Pearls – 50pcs Snowflakes White P30
- Buddly Crafts Flatback Rose Pearls – 50pcs 12mm Ivory P13
- Knorr Prandell 1mm Bakers Twine – 20m – Red #012
- Buddly Crafts 8mm Spacer Beads – 70pcs Silver SP3
Color the cone with the StazOn pigment ink pad.
Cut 6x3cm piece of the jute fabric and cut at the middle long side.
Start glueing the drift wood pieces beginning from the base of the cone and adding between them pieces of jute fabric.
Continue to top, trying to place smaller size wood pieces.
Make small bows with the gingham ribbon, place the on the tree and a flatback rose.
Cut 6cm long pieces of the bakers twine and make loops.
Glue them on the tree and place a pearl snowflake on top of them.
Add spacer beads to embellish further.
